Hello Beautiful: Break free from the chains of regret, self doubt and comparison, and discover the freedom, power and beauty of being the real you.

Rate this book
When was the last time you felt good about yourself, worthy and capable of achieving what it is you want out of life? Has it been so long since you felt comfortable in your own skin, you forgot what it even feels like? Are you tired of feeling powerless and trapped in your own life because there is no way, no matter how much you beg, wish and pray, to go back and experience a different past? It could make you wonder if life is even worth it. Perhaps you already have. What if there is a different life waiting for you . . . an alternate universe of sorts, running right along side of you, and the only challenge is that it
